    General information The HPCU360iCM control unit is intended for a heat pump control and for controlling of space heating and cooling, and for domestic hot water (DHW) preparation as well.   • Page 26 • Cool water temp. hysteresis - if the cool water temperature exceeds the Cool water temperature by the Cool water temp. hysteresis value, the heat pump will stop generating cool water. Parameter available only with circuit cooling function on. The menu contains settings related to the support of the DHW tank. •...
  • Page 27 • Comfort – setting higher preset heating/cooling circuit temperature. • Eco – setting lower preset heating/cooling circuit temperature. • Auto – Comfort or Eco mode is set depending on the time schedule. The heating/cooling circuit pump is blocked when the room thermostat is active for the heating/cooling circuit.
